Isolation and Analysis of Essential Oils from Spices
O'Shea, Stephen K.; Von Riesen, Daniel D.; Rossi, Lauren L.
Journal of Chemical Education, v89 n5 p665-668 Apr 2012
Natural product isolation and analysis provide an opportunity to present a variety of experimental techniques to undergraduate students in introductory organic chemistry. Eugenol, anethole, and carvone were extracted from six common spices using steam-distillation and diethyl ether as the extraction solvent. Students assessed the purity of their spice extract and identified its components via TLC, reverse-phase HPLC, and GC-MS analyses. In addition, students reviewed molecular characteristics and interactions while discovering the similarities and differences among the six spice extracts. (Contains 2 tables.)
